PostInstallation Maintenance
After the installation of your water heater, routine maintenance is essential to ensure its longevity and optimal performance. Regularly inspect the temperature settings on the thermostat, keeping it within the recommended range of 120 to 140 degrees Fahrenheit. Flushing the tank once a year can help remove sediment buildup, which can affect efficiency and lead to premature wear. Additionally, check for leaks around the fittings, as even minor leaks can cause significant damage over time.

How can I maintain my water heater after installation?
To maintain your water heater, regularly check the temperature setting, flush the tank annually to remove sediment buildup, inspect for leaks, and test the pressure relief valve. Schedule professional maintenance as needed to keep it in top condition.
